MySQL是一種關系型數據庫管理系統,與其他數據庫管理系統相比,MySQL具有以下優點:
1. 開源:MySQL是開源數據庫,不需要任何授權費用,可以免費使用。 2. 跨平臺:MySQL適用于多種操作系統,如Windows、Linux、Mac OS等等。 3. 多線程:MySQL支持多線程,可以在復雜的高并發應用場景下順利應對。 4. 高性能:MySQL采用了多種優化技術,可以提高查詢效率,保證數據庫的高性能。 5. 具有豐富的功能:MySQL具有完善的存儲過程、觸發器、視圖等功能,可以滿足開發人員的需求。
與此相反,一些其他數據庫具有以下不足:
1. 授權費用高:一些商業數據庫要求用戶支付授權費用,這會增加開發成本。 2. 限制:某些數據庫可能會限制用戶的使用,以此控制用戶數據和應用程序的自由度。 3. 不便于跨平臺使用:和MySQL相比,其他一些數據庫不太適用于多種操作系統。 4. 查詢效率低:一些非關系型數據庫雖然存儲效率高,但在查詢效率上略顯不足。 5. 功能不全面:有些數據庫可能缺少在數據管理中常見的一些功能,如觸發器等等。
總的來說,MySQL作為開源、跨平臺、高性能、功能豐富的關系型數據庫管理系統,在數據庫領域中占據著很重要的地位。與其他數據庫相比,MySQL的優點更為突出,可以更好地滿足用戶的需求。
上一篇css動態打鉤